How they compare
Mongolia currently reports 13,443 against 13,205 in Egypt, a difference of 238.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 73 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Egypt ahead.
Egypt ranks 81st and Mongolia ranks 80th of 165 countries.
Across the 8 decades both report, Egypt averaged higher in 6 and Mongolia in 2.
